Understanding the Legal Landscape

Selling alcohol isn't as straightforward as other products due to the stringent regulations governing its sale and distribution. The legal framework varies significantly across regions, affecting everything from who can sell alcohol to how it's marketed and delivered.

Federal, State, and Local Laws

In the United States, alcohol sales are heavily regulated at both the federal and state levels, with each state having its own set of rules. This means that online retailers need to be mindful of not just the laws of the state where their business is located, but also the laws of the states to which they intend to ship alcohol.

Licensing Requirements

Generally, selling alcohol online requires obtaining relevant licenses, which can include both a personal license (proving the individual's eligibility to oversee alcohol sales) and a premises license (designating your business location as a legal point of dispatch for alcoholic goods). The process for obtaining these licenses involves both educational components and application procedures, varying by locality.

Age Verification and Shipping

A critical aspect of selling alcohol online is ensuring that purchasers are of legal drinking age. Shopify sellers must implement robust age verification processes at checkout to comply with legal requirements. Additionally, shipping alcohol comes with its own set of challenges, as carriers often have specific policies and states have different regulations on the importation of alcoholic beverages.

The Role of Shopify in Alcohol Sales

Shopify, as a comprehensive e-commerce platform, does support merchants wishing to sell alcohol, under the condition that they adhere to all applicable laws and Shopify's own policies. Here's what potential sellers need to know:

Compliance First

Before setting up shop, you must ensure your business is compliant with the relevant legal requirements. This entails having the right licenses in place, understanding the laws of your target markets, and setting up age verification systems.

Choosing the Right Payment Gateway

While Shopify Payments might be a convenient option for many Shopify merchants, the sale of alcohol introduces complexities in the choice of payment gateways. It's essential to verify whether Shopify Payments or your chosen third-party payment processor supports transactions for alcohol sales in your target markets.

Utilizing Shopify's Features

Shopify offers a range of features that can help manage the intricacies of selling alcohol online. From age verification apps available in the Shopify App Store to detailed shipping and tax settings that can be adjusted based on jurisdiction, Shopify provides tools to navigate the regulatory landscape successfully.

Best Practices for Selling Alcohol on Shopify

To ensure a smooth operation and legal compliance, consider the following best practices when selling alcohol on Shopify:

  • Educate Yourself and Stay Updated: Laws and regulations around alcohol sales can change. Continuous education and staying abreast of legal developments are crucial.
  • Transparent Communication: Clearly inform your customers about shipping restrictions, age verification processes, and any other pertinent information through your website's content.
  • Invest in Age Verification Technology: Employ robust age verification at checkout to ensure compliance with legal age requirements.
  • Work with Knowledgeable Partners: From legal counsel to shipping partners, working with entities familiar with the alcohol sales domain can help mitigate risks and ensure compliance.

FAQ

Q: Can I use Shopify Payments for selling alcohol?
A: Shopify Payments might support alcohol sales, subject to manual review and depending on your location and compliance with legal requirements. It's advisable to directly consult Shopify and review the terms of Shopify Payments for the most accurate information.

Q: Do I need a liquor license to sell alcohol on Shopify?
A: Yes, you will generally need a liquor license appropriate to your business model and the jurisdictions you operate in. The specifics can vary based on local laws.

Q: Can I sell alcohol to customers in any state from my Shopify store?
A: The ability to sell and ship alcohol to customers in different states depends on both the laws of the state where your business is based and the laws of the customer's state. Some states have stringent restrictions on alcohol shipments from out-of-state sellers.

Q: How do I ensure my customers are of legal drinking age?
A: Implementing an age verification process at checkout is essential. Shopify offers apps that can facilitate this process, helping you comply with legal requirements.

Q: Can I sell alcohol on Shopify internationally?
A: Selling alcohol to international customers adds another layer of complexity, as you must comply with the import laws of the destination country and potentially deal with duties and taxes. Thorough research and consultation with legal experts are advisable before pursuing international sales.
